Strategic Dialogues

Illicit financial flows from Africa (IFFs): reflections on the 2020 UNCTAD report ‘Tackling Illicit Financial Flows for Sustainable Development in Africa’.

October 28, 2020

We engage Edwin Ikhouria, Executive Director of the ONE Campaign,on the latest report by the UNCTAD on IFFs from Africa and the impact on African development and, more importantly, what this means for Africa’s agency in global affairs.


Podbean App

Play this podcast on Podbean App